  • posted a message on Mono Green or Selesnya thoughts?
    I think you can get a solid deck out of either, but I like the flexibility that multi-colored decks bring. Sure, you can get away with a cheaper manabase if you rock a mono color, but you also open yourself up to risks, like Iona. At the same time, green offers some of the best removal, but so does white, so pairing them together can be pretty powerful.

    At the end of the day... I think it's up to you. What do you like better?

    EDIT: Another thought that kind of came to me as I was sitting thinking about the two decks I am in the process of building/rebuilding... The thing I like about EDH more than a lot of formats is... It's really about what you want to play. You can ask for advice and suggestions, but you should really build and play what you want to. If you want to run all of the hottest winfast/more cards, that's your choice. If not? Your choice too. Play the color that tickles your fancy with the cards that get you excited, and be happy about it. I hope whatever you land on is fun.
